Increased frequency of extreme weather is now consistently linked to climate change through attribution science, making it the most empirically grounded effect on this list. Specific heatwaves, floods, and hurricanes have been quantified: for example, climate change made Hurricane Harvey’s rainfall 38% more intense. This precision outperforms #8 (Climate Migration and Displacement), which still relies on projections. However, the debate remains because exact amplification ratios—like the 15% boost from a 1°C rise versus natural variability—vary by event type. An authoritative 2023 study showed that 74% of all extreme precipitation events now bear a detectable human fingerprint, but critics note that models overestimate some local trends. The practical import: insurers now use these attributions to adjust premiums, a concrete market response.
